Patio Sealing in Kitsap County, WA
Patio sealing services involve applying a protective coating to outdoor surfaces such as concrete, stone, or pavers to enhance durability and appearance. This process helps prevent damage from weather elements, staining, and wear over time, making it a popular choice for patios, walkways, and outdoor entertainment areas. Projects typically include cleaning the surface beforehand and then sealing it with a specialized product designed to penetrate and protect the material, extending its lifespan and maintaining its aesthetic appeal.
Homeowners interested in patio sealing usually want to understand the types of sealants available, the benefits of sealing, and how it can improve the longevity of their outdoor spaces. It’s also important to consider the condition of the existing surface, as sealing may be most effective on clean, intact materials. Property owners often seek guidance on the best timing for sealing, especially after completing renovations or cleaning, and want to ensure the chosen service will help preserve their outdoor investments while maintaining a natural look.

Patio Sealing Questions
What is patio sealing? Patio sealing involves applying a protective coating to surfaces like concrete, stone, or pavers to prevent damage from water, stains, and wear.
Why should property owners consider patio sealing? Sealing helps preserve the appearance of the patio, reduces staining, and extends the lifespan of the surface.
What types of patios benefit most from sealing? Concrete, stone, and paver patios often benefit the most, especially in areas exposed to weather and heavy use.
How often should a patio be resealed? It is generally recommended to reseal every few years to maintain protection and appearance.
